Keep It Clear — Pro Tips

The last step is upkeep. Three habits that stop the next clog before it starts:

Monthly enzyme drain treatment Mesh screens on shower & sink drains Never pour grease down the kitchen line

Yes. That's the point of the sequence: the camera tells you what you're dealing with, and the machine does the hard work with foot-switch control. Most first-timers clear a typical household clog in under an hour.
Hair and soap buildup in bathroom lines, kitchen grease, and main-line blockages within cable reach. The camera helps you confirm the clog type before you start — if it turns out to be a collapsed pipe or tree roots deep in the main, that's when you call the pro.
